KSI and Logan Paul’s PRIME Signs Deal with FC Barcelona as Official Hydration Partner

KSI and Logan Paul owned energy drink PRIME has officially become the hydration sponsor of FC Barcelona for the upcoming season.

Ever since its launch, PRIME has become arguably one of the most popular energy drink brands rivaling the likes of Red Bull and Monster. KSI and Logan Paul have worked hard to bring in deals that have ultimately benefitted the brand and helped it grow and this one with FC Barcelona will be their greatest venture yet.

We all know the critical financial condition FC Barcelona is going through which might have opened the opportunity for PRIME to become one of their sponsors. Despite their economic woes, FC Barcelone remains one of the biggest footballing brands with legions of followers across the globe.

Their unrivaled fame will help PRIME reach a larger audience and no better way to promote an energy drink than to associate themselves with a top sporting brand.

“We could not be more proud and excited to serve as the newest Official Hydration Partner with one of the most iconic teams in any sport, FC Barcelona. Whether it’s a mid-game refuel or post-training recovery, we can’t wait for the FC Barcelona family to level up with Prime,” said KSI and Logan Paul.

“This US company’s hydration products will be visible during games -in the bench area- and training sessions involving the men’s, women’s, and youth football teams. PRIME will also take a privileged place in these teams’ dressing rooms and will also feature in the Palau Blaugrana.” read the club’s statement.

According to the information revealed, PRIME will appear around the bench of men’s, women’s, and youth teams. PRIME will replace Gatorade who held positions in similar areas for the next three seasons, however, the financials are undisclosed as of yet.
